VPS指针是什么?解析其在编程和服务器管理中的应用

VPS指针是什么?它在编程和虚拟服务器中有何应用?

概念 定义 应用场景
VPS指针 在编程中指指向VPS相关数据的指针变量 用于管理VPS服务器资源、优化性能等
普通指针 存储内存地址的变量 数据共享、复杂数据结构构建等

揭秘2025年SEO俱乐部核心玩法:3个让流量翻倍的实战技巧

保康SEO推广怎么做?_# 保康SEO推广怎么做?本地企业必看的实战指南

# VPS指针的概念与应用解析

## 什么是VPS指针
VPS指针是一个结合了虚拟专用服务器(VPS)和编程指针概念的术语。在编程中,指针是一种存储内存地址的变量,而VPS指针特指向与VPS服务器相关数据的指针变量^^1^^2^^。
指针的基本特点包括:
- 存储的是内存地址而非实际数据
- 大小固定(32位系统4字节,64位系统8字节)
- 通过解引用操作符(*)访问指向的数据

## VPS指针的主要用途
VPS指针在服务器管理和编程中有以下应用场景:
1. **资源管理**:指向VPS上的内存、磁盘等资源,便于高效管理^^3^^
2. **性能优化**:通过指针直接访问关键数据,减少复制开销^^1^^
3. **远程控制**:在VPS远程管理工具中用于指向服务器状态信息^^4^^

## 常见问题与解决方案

问题 原因 解决方案
指针越界 访问了未分配的内存区域 使用前检查指针有效性
内存泄漏 未释放指针指向的内存 及时调用free()等释放函数
性能下降 指针频繁解引用 优化数据结构,减少间接访问

莆田企业SEO优化怎么做?_五个关键步骤提升本地搜索排名

罗源SEO公司哪家强_本地SEO优化团队对比(深度测评3家技术实力与案例)

## 技术实现细节
在C语言中定义VPS指针的基本语法:
```c
// 定义指向整型的VPS指针
int* vps_ptr = &vps_resource_count;
// 定义指向结构体的VPS指针
typedef struct {
int cpu_usage;
int memory_usage;
} VPSStatus;
VPSStatus* vps_status_ptr = ¤t_status;
```
使用指针时需要注意:
- 初始化指针变量
- 避免野指针(未初始化的指针)
- 及时释放不再使用的内存^^5^^6^^
通过合理使用VPS指针,可以更高效地管理虚拟服务器资源,提升应用程序性能。但同时也需要注意指针使用的安全性,避免常见的内存管理问题。

发表评论

评论列表